What the chief warden actually does
The chief warden leads the site's Emergency Control Organisation, or ECO. In plain terms, they collaborate people throughout an occurrence and make the judgment calls that impact everyone's safety. That consists of fires, medical emergency situations, chemical spills, power failures, escalator entrapments, and the all as well typical dud that still needs a disciplined action. The chief warden's obligations start with avoidance and readiness, proceed via case control, and finish with organized recovery.
On a routine day, the chief warden checks that wardens are rostered, communication devices job, emptying routes remain clear, and any impairments to fire systems are understood and minimized. During an event, they take control from the emergency situation control point, validate the nature of the occurrence, choose the first response setting, and straight area wardens and wardens to sweep, isolate risks, help persons that require aid, and take care of setting up locations. Later, they log the series, debrief, and drive improvements.
The title varies. Some organisations call the role chief fire warden or chief emergency warden. Skills you can not fake
Crisis leadership looks glamorous theoretically, but in a smoke-logged corridor with alarms shrieking and the lift inactive, gloss gives way to muscle memory. Chief warden requirements gather right into decision-making, communication, coordination, and technological literacy. The following are not nice-to-haves, they are the back of the role.

Decisive judgment under pressure. Occurrences compensate those that act on minimal details and upgrade fast. The chief warden needs to pick whether to leave, safeguard in position, or phase a partial emptying, then adapt as problems alter. Wavering costs minutes, and mins cost people.
Clear, succinct interactions. During an alarm, your words battle sound, fear, and radio blockage. Excellent principal wardens use short, direct phrases and repeat essential orders. They verify vital messages back, time-stamp actions, and avoid jargon that confuses wardens or occupants. If you have actually ever tried to run a stairwell down-sweep while upkeep tricks right into the panel and protection reports smell of smoke on level 3, you know brevity matters.
Span of‑control technique. The chief warden hardly ever touches every flooring directly. They overcome area wardens and wardens, typically in a ratio that maintains the chain of command clean. They prevent freelancing and stand up to the urge to micromanage a single flooring while blowing up of the rest.
Situational awareness. This sounds cosy until you exercise it. A great chief warden assumes in maps. They recognize the structure's areas, stair pressurisation, re-entry levels, fire door places, and the unusual choke points where people bunch. They note the weather if it impacts outside setting up security, the time of day if it alters occupancy, and the upkeep status of fire sign panels, EWIS, and reductions systems.
Calm authority. Individuals will certainly review your face before your words. A chief warden emits a gauged tranquility that swipes oxygen from panic. That tone carries over the PA, on the radio, and in your stance at the control point.
Documentation discipline. Logs, head counts, problems permits, and debrief actions do not exist for bureaucracy's purpose. They permit you to show due diligence, meet fire warden requirements in the workplace, and boost the following response.
The training that builds those skills
In Australia, two devices sit at the heart of warden and chief warden training. They map to the nationwide structure and give a consistent baseline.
PUAFER005 operate as component of an emergency situation control organisation. This is the foundational fire warden course that builds practical abilities for wardens and location wardens. A great puafer005 course covers alarm system acknowledgment, ECO structure, communication procedures, discharge techniques, assisting mobility-impaired owners, and liaison with emergency solutions. You desire functional drills, not simply concept. Genuine lessons originate from relocating bodies down staircases, not reviewing it.
PUAFER006 lead an emergency situation control organisation. This is the dive to management. A puafer006 course will push you right into scenario preparation, command and control, announcements, source allowance, and making emptying setting decisions. It ought to include time at a fire indicator panel and EWIS, running mock situations with injects that compel you to pivot.
Those two units rest inside a wider program of warden training that ought to consist of annual refresher courses and building-specific inductions. The nationwide devices give you typical language and assumptions. The website induction gives you truth. In one property I sustained, the cellar had a low ceiling and a tangle of solution runs that trapped warmth. A textbook method to a car park fire required change or you would push hot smoke directly the ramp toward the primary entry. You only discover that on site.
If your operation consists of numerous states or intricate risks, search for a chief warden course that mixes PUAFER006 with extra components like bomb hazard evaluation, hostile intruder treatments, and service continuity causes. Some providers plan chief fire warden training with desktop exercises for the management group. That is cash well invested. Emergencies touch human resources, IT, safety and security, and media. You desire lined up playbooks.

Fire warden training demands and freshen cycles
Fire warden requirements vary by jurisdiction and building use, yet several patterns hold. Wardens, consisting of the chief warden, must complete official training and freshen at regular intervals. Yearly refreshers are standard for high-occupancy or facility websites. Two-year cycles might serve for low-risk environments, given you run drills a minimum of twice a year and swear in brand-new staff promptly.
Refreshers must not rework slides. Usage recent cases and building adjustments. If your site added a brand-new renter fit-out with access control modifications, run a drill that examines the new badge visitors under emergency power. If a stairway pressurisation fault occurred last quarter, clarify what transformed after the repair and include a scenario that checks system performance.
For evidence, keep training records, attendance logs, and post-drill records with activity close-outs. Regulatory authorities and insurance companies pay attention to the paper trail. More notably, the documentation reveals your group that continual enhancement matters.
Colour coding and aesthetic cues
Wardens and primary wardens require to be quickly recognisable. That is where tabards, headgears, and hats come in. Colour conventions differ by nation and sometimes by organisation, yet in Australia, chief warden hat colour is generally white. The chief fire warden hat or headgear is white for the chief, while flooring or area wardens typically use yellow. The deputy chief warden will certainly sometimes wear white with a various stripe or a significant tabard so they are very easy to find at the control factor. In some offices, red signifies a communications warden or a first strike firefighter, and green may be scheduled for emergency treatment. If you are asking what colour helmet does a chief warden wear, confirm your neighborhood requirement, then make it regular across the website. Whatever you pick, train it, label it, and stock spares.
There is one useful care. Hats and headgears help, however tabards are less complicated to save and faster to don, specifically for personnel who put on head treatments or work in functions where a helmet is not practical. The most effective arrangements keep both, using safety helmets for risky industrial websites and tabards for offices and retail.
The ECO at work: an instance from the field
A multi-storey office tower, mid-morning. A scent of burning reported on degree 12. The chief warden gets a call from security and a concurrent alert on the fire indicator panel. The zone shows a detector in a comms space, a well-known location. The chief warden relocates to the control point, places on the white tabard, and opens the EWIS. They switch degree 12 to sharp tone and program a quick news: wardens examine, residents wait for instructions.
Area wardens on level 12 recognize on the radio. One comes close to the comms area door. Warmth exists, door surface area warm, light smoke visible under the threshold. They do closed the door. The chief warden escalates to discharge tone for degree 12 and the flooring above, then dispatches wardens to handle stairwells and straight individuals away from the smoke course. Security isolates the cooling and heating to prevent spread. The chief warden calls the fire brigade if the system has actually not already done so instantly, and fulfills staffs at the panel with a concise handover: suspected electrical fire in a comms space, doors closed, partial emptying underway, no reported injuries, stairwells clear, lifts isolated.
The brigade arrives and extend. The chief warden holds the line, maintains various other floors on sharp, and assigns a runner to check on an occupant with two mobility device customers. Emptying proceeds. Within mins, firemans confirm a small shelf fire, regulated rapidly. The chief warden keeps the evacuation till the location is aerated and the brigade provides the green light. After the incident, the chief warden documents times, activities, and concerns. The debrief results in a simple enhancement: mount thermal detection inside comms closets and upgrade the tenant's equipment tons limits.
This is the work. Not significant, but disciplined.

Building the ECO: functions and structure
A chief warden does not carry the building alone. The ECO consists of deputy chief warden, interactions officer, floor or location wardens, and wardens that sweep, help, and take care of assembly points. In facility sites, you may add duties for owners with particular demands, emergency treatment, and security integration.
Structure needs to match the building's risk profile. A high-rise with combined renters could assign 2 location wardens per flooring to cover leave. A distribution center with change job needs wardens across all shifts, not simply the day crew. A lab requires wardens who understand containment procedures and know when a standard discharge could make things worse by pressing fumes into public areas.
Match people to roles with purpose. A few of the most effective wardens I have actually seen are receptionists. They know that is on website, keep a cool head under stress, and can guide naturally. In heavy sector, look for staff leads who keep technique and understand the plant. Your replacement chief warden must be a person with real presence, not just a title holder.
The human side: passengers that need additional help
Fire warden demands in the work environment should represent people who can not get down fifteen flights quickly. People with temporary injuries, mobility disabilities, aesthetic or hearing differences, late-stage maternity, anxiousness problems, and site visitors not familiar with the site need thoughtful planning. Begin with Personal Emergency Discharge Plans. Maintain them very discreet and functional. Determine pal systems and haven points. Outfit stairwells with evac chairs and train wardens who are literally capable and comfortable using them. Do not presume the best person is the best choice. Method and confidence trump brute force.
During drills, imitate, do not carry out, particular activities if there is any kind of threat of injury. Practice the steps with devices in regulated problems. If an individual likes to continue to be in place at a refuge point under a defend-in-place technique, write that right into the strategy in addition to communication procedures and signage.
Coordination with emergency situation services
A chief warden is the bridge between your structure and the responders. That connection starts prior to the emergency situation. Welcome the local brigade to a walkthrough. Program them the hydrant places, fire control area, FIP, EWIS, sprinkler shutoffs, and the traits that just locals know. Exchange get in touch with details for after-hours website access.
During a case, the handover is short and organized: what you have, what you have actually done, what you require. Supply structure strategies, tricks, impairment standing, and headcounts if available. After that step back and take care of the occupants. Do not crowd the fire control space or shadow firemans unless welcomed. Your work continues on the human side.

Common challenges and exactly how to stay clear of them
The most constant failure is drift. A new chief warden obtains trained, drills run well for a year, after that people move functions, radios go missing out on, and discharge representations age out. The remedy is rhythm. Set a calendar for quarterly ECO conferences, 2 drills a year, annual refresher courses, and month-to-month checks of equipment and departures. Treat it like procedures, not a once-a-year compliance tick.
Another challenge is over-evacuation. Pulling a full-building discharge for every single minor alarm system uses people out. Make use of the tools you have. Phase alert and emptying tones by area, examine rapidly, and escalate decisively when needed. This is where puafer006 training makes its keep.
Finally, do not ignore post-incident exhaustion. After an actual occasion, wardens might feel rattled. A short debrief that recognizes initiative, shares truths, and assigns convenient enhancements does a lot more for strength than any type of poster on a wall.
